/****************************************************************
 *
 * System Dependent Definitions
 *
 *
 * XtArgVal ought to be a union of caddr_t, char *, long, int *, and proc *
 * but casting to union types is not really supported.
 *
 * So the typedef for XtArgVal should be chosen such that
 *
 *      sizeof (XtArgVal) >=	sizeof(caddr_t)
 *				sizeof(char *)
 *				sizeof(long)
 *				sizeof(int *)
 *				sizeof(proc *)
 *
 * ArgLists rely heavily on the above typedef.
 *
 ****************************************************************/
typedef long XtArgVal;

/******************************************************************
 *
 * Core Class Structure. Widgets, regardless of their class, will have
 * these fields.  All widgets of a given class will have the same values
 * for these fields.  Widgets of a given class may also have additional
 * common fields.  These additional fields are included in incremental
 * class structures, such as CommandClass.
 *
 * The fields that are specific to this subclass, as opposed to fields that
 * are part of the superclass, are called "subclass fields" below.  Many
 * procedures are responsible only for the subclass fields, and not for
 * any superclass fields.
 *
 ********************************************************************/

typedef struct _CoreClassPart {
    WidgetClass	    superclass;	       /* pointer to superclass ClassRec     */
    String          class_name;	       /* widget resource class name         */
    Cardinal        widget_size;       /* size in bytes of widget record     */
    XtProc	    class_initialize;  /* class initialization proc	     */
    Boolean         class_inited;      /* has class been initialized?        */
    XtInitProc      initialize;	       /* initialize subclass fields         */
    XtRealizeProc   realize;	       /* XCreateWindow for widget	     */
    XtActionList    actions;	       /* widget semantics name to proc map  */
    Cardinal	    num_actions;       /* number of entries in actions       */
    XtResourceList  resources;	       /* resources for subclass fields      */
    Cardinal        num_resources;     /* number of entries in resources     */
    XrmClass        xrm_class;	       /* resource class quarkified	     */
    Boolean         compress_motion;   /* compress MotionNotify for widget   */
    Boolean         compress_exposure; /* compress Expose events for widget  */
    Boolean         visible_interest;  /* select for VisibilityNotify        */
    XtWidgetProc    destroy;	       /* free data for subclass pointers    */
    XtWidgetProc    resize;	       /* geom manager changed widget size   */
    XtExposeProc    expose;	       /* rediplay window		     */
    XtSetValuesProc set_values;	       /* set subclass resource values       */
    XtWidgetProc    accept_focus;      /* assign input focus to widget       */
  } CoreClassPart;

typedef struct _WidgetClassRec {
    CoreClassPart core_class;
} WidgetClassRec;

extern WidgetClassRec widgetClassRec;
extern WidgetClass widgetClass;
